McDonald's is testing bigger and smaller versions of its Big Mac as the world's largest hamburger chain pushes to revive its business.

The company says it is testing a Grand Mac and Mac Jr in the central Ohio and Dallas areas and will see how they do before deciding on a national roll-out.
